Ricciardo frustrated at failed Ferrari or Mercedes move

Daniel Ricciardo has revealed his frustration at the current market for driver transfers and a move to Mercedes or Ferrari that failed to materialise after he made the decision to leave Red Bull, as he believes they will once again be the two teams to beat in 2019. During the 2018 season, Ricciardo announced he would be leaving Red Bull in favour of Renault, despite the French team being viewed as a midtable outfit.
